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
1.0 - 3.0 years
2 - 11 Lacs
Remote, , India
Remote
About the Role: We are looking for a passionate Junior Front-End Developer with hands-on experience or strong interest in building browser-based video editing applications . You'll work on creating interactive, real-time video editing features similar to tools like Canva , Kapwing , or Clipchamp , using cutting-edge technologies like FFmpeg in the browser , WebAssembly , Canvas , and WebGL . This is a unique opportunity to contribute to a video editing SaaS platform that pushes the boundaries of what's possible in the browser. Key Responsibilities: Build and maintain interactive UI components for a browser-based video editor using React.js and the Canvas API . Implement features like timeline editing , clip trimming , drag-and-drop support , filters/transitions , and multi-track editing . Work with rendering frameworks such as Fabric.js , Three.js , or WebGL for visual manipulation. Integrate browser-based video/audio processing tools such as FFmpeg (via WebAssembly) and MediaRecorder API . Develop features for audio waveform editing and frame-by-frame control . Collaborate with the design and backend teams to create smooth, performant user experiences. Maintain a clean, reusable, and well-documented codebase. Required Skills & Experience: 6 months to 2 years of experience in front-end development. Strong command of JavaScript (ES6+) , React.js , HTML5 , and CSS3 . Experience working with Canvas API , Fabric.js , or similar libraries. Understanding of browser APIs such as MediaRecorder , WebCodecs , and WebAssembly . Familiarity with video processing in the browser using FFmpeg.wasm or similar. Ability to implement responsive, pixel-perfect UI with interactive elements. Experience using Git for version control. Nice to Have: Exposure to Three.js for video or 3D rendering in the browser. Knowledge of audio/video sync , multi-track timelines, or frame management. Experience with Lottie animations in conjunction with video layers. Familiarity with SaaS video editing tools like Canva, Clipchamp, or InVideo. Basic understanding of performance tuning for real-time rendering in the browser. What We Offer: Work on a next-gen browser-based video editing product. A creative, fast-paced startup environment with room to grow. Hands-on exposure to advanced browser technologies. Supportive mentorship and opportunities for technical advancement. Competitive salary, flexible hours, and remote-friendly culture If interested, please mail your resume at [HIDDEN TEXT] Feel free to call 8108521337
Posted 2 weeks 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
55803 Jobs | Dublin
Wipro
24489 Jobs | Bengaluru
Accenture in India
19138 Jobs | Dublin 2
EY
17347 Jobs | London
Uplers
12706 Jobs | Ahmedabad
IBM
11805 Jobs | Armonk
Bajaj Finserv
11514 Jobs |
Amazon
11476 Jobs | Seattle,WA
Accenture services Pvt Ltd
10903 Jobs |
Oracle
10677 Jobs | Redwood City